编程语言中如何将数字取整
发布时间:2025-05-23 08:44:34 发布人:远客网络
一、编程语言中如何将数字取整
要将一个数字取整,可以使用不同的取整方法,具体取决于你希望得到的结果。以下是常见的几种取整方法:
1.向下取整(Floor):向下取整是将一个数字朝着负无穷方向舍入到最接近的较小整数。在数学符号中通常用符号"⌊x⌋"表示。在大多数编程语言中,可以使用 floor()函数实现向下取整。
2.向上取整(Ceiling):向上取整是将一个数字朝着正无穷方向舍入到最接近的较大整数。在数学符号中通常用符号"⌈x⌉"表示。在大多数编程语言中,可以使用 ceil()函数实现向上取整。
3.四舍五入(Round):四舍五入是将一个数字根据其小数部分进行舍入,如果小数部分大于等于 0.5,则舍入到较大整数,否则舍入到较小整数。在数学符号中通常用符号"round(x)"或"x"上面有一个波浪线表示。在大多数编程语言中,可以使用 round()函数实现四舍五入。
4.截断(Truncate):截断是将一个数字直接去掉其小数部分,保留整数部分。在数学符号中通常用符号"[x]"表示。在大多数编程语言中,可以使用整数类型的数据或转换为整数来实现截断。
请根据你的具体需求选择适合的取整方法。如果你在特定的编程环境中,你也可以查阅相关的编程文档以了解如何在该编程语言中进行数字取整操作。
二、编程猫中有哪些数
1.整数:编程猫中的整数是指没有小数部分的数字。例如,1、2、3等都是整数。在编程中,整数通常用来表示数量、次数、位置等。
2.浮点数:编程猫中的浮点数是指带小数部分的数字。例如,1.0、2.5、3.14等都是浮点数。在编程中,浮点数通常用来表示实数、比例、坐标等。
3.复数:编程猫中的复数是指实部和虚部组成的数字。例如,1+2i、3-4i等都是复数。在编程中,复数通常用来表示电路、信号处理、图像处理等领域。
4.布尔数:编程猫中的布尔数是指只有两个值(True和False)的数字。在编程中,布尔数通常用来表示逻辑判断、条件分支、循环等。
此外,编程猫中还包含了其他的数值类型,例如长整型、双精度浮点数、定点数等。这些数值类型在不同的编程语言中可能会有所不同。
三、编程语言中如何进行数字取整
要将一个数字取整,可以使用不同的取整方法,具体取决于你希望得到的结果。以下是常见的几种取整方法:
1.向下取整(Floor):向下取整是将一个数字朝着负无穷方向舍入到最接近的较小整数。在数学符号中通常用符号"⌊x⌋"表示。在大多数编程语言中,可以使用 floor()函数实现向下取整。
2.向上取整(Ceiling):向上取整是将一个数字朝着正无穷方向舍入到最接近的较大整数。在数学符号中通常用符号"⌈x⌉"表示。在大多数编程语言中,可以使用 ceil()函数实现向上取整。
3.四舍五入(Round):四舍五入是将一个数字根据其小数部分进行舍入,如果小数部分大于等于 0.5,则舍入到较大整数,否则舍入到较小整数。在数学符号中通常用符号"round(x)"或"x"上面有一个波浪线表示。在大多数编程语言中,可以使用 round()函数实现四舍五入。
4.截断(Truncate):截断是将一个数字直接去掉其小数部分,保留整数部分。在数学符号中通常用符号"[x]"表示。在大多数编程语言中,可以使用整数类型的数据或转换为整数来实现截断。
请根据你的具体需求选择适合的取整方法。如果你在特定的编程环境中,你也可以查阅相关的编程文档以了解如何在该编程语言中进行数字取整操作。